TL;DR
Senior Robotics Software Engineer (Computer Vision): Developing and deploying perception systems for manipulation and mobile robotics with an accent on object understanding, sensor integration, dataset development, and real-time inference. Focus on building reliable vision-to-action pipelines, diagnosing field and lab failures, and optimizing models for robot compute.
Location: Bristol, United Kingdom
Company
develops robotic systems that use perception, learning, and control software for manipulation and mobile robotics.
What you will do
- Develop perception systems for object detection, segmentation, tracking, pose estimation, depth, scene understanding, and task-state recognition.
- Build vision capabilities for grasping, manipulation, navigation, human awareness, and closed-loop robot behavior.
- Create datasets through collection, annotation, synthetic generation, augmentation, active learning, and failure mining.
- Design offline and on-robot evaluations covering accuracy, calibration, robustness, latency, and downstream task impact.
- Integrate cameras and depth sensors, addressing calibration, synchronization, coordinate transforms, noise, and hardware-specific failures.
- Deploy and optimize perception pipelines for real-time robot inference with logging, monitoring, fallback behavior, and regression coverage.
Requirements
- Practical experience developing computer-vision or multimodal perception systems beyond classroom projects.
- Strong Python skills and substantial experience with PyTorch or an equivalent deep-learning framework.
- Knowledge of modern vision methods including detection, segmentation, tracking, pose estimation, depth, or representation learning.
- Experience building datasets, training models, selecting metrics, and performing structured error analysis.
- Understanding of camera geometry, calibration, coordinate systems, and the connection between perception outputs and physical-world decisions.
- At least three years of relevant work experience and a degree in computer science, machine learning, robotics, engineering, or a related field, or equivalent practical experience.
Nice to have
- Experience with robotic manipulation, mobile robots, autonomous systems, or embodied AI.
- Knowledge of 6D pose estimation, visual servoing, grasp perception, articulated-object understanding, or hand-object interaction.
- Experience with RGB-D, stereo, event cameras, LiDAR, or multi-camera systems.
- Knowledge of CUDA, TensorRT, ONNX, ROS/ROS 2, or embedded and edge GPU deployment.
- Experience with synthetic data, domain randomization, simulation, sim-to-real transfer, open-vocabulary perception, vision-language models, or multimodal foundation models.
